hand auger AWTOOLS AW00104
The AWTOOLS AW00104 hand auger is a compact manual drilling tool designed for digging planting holes and small post holes with minimal effort. Constructed from hardened and forged steel with a powder-coated finish, the auger is built for durability and resistance to wear. Its triple-blade solid shaft and sharply pointed tip improve soil penetration, while the ergonomic wide handle covered with non-slip material provides a secure grip during operation. Made in Poland, this tool is suitable for routine gardening and light landscaping tasks where controlled, precise holes are required.
The hand auger combines a robust forged-steel construction with a protective powder coating to extend service life and resist corrosion. The triple-blade shaft and pointed tip reduce the effort required to break and remove soil, increasing digging efficiency compared with simple spiral designs. The wide ergonomically shaped handle with non-slip covering reduces hand fatigue and improves control, allowing for straighter, cleaner holes. Its compact manual design makes it quiet, low-maintenance, and easy to transport.
Position the pointed tip at the chosen spot and apply steady downward pressure while turning the tool clockwise to cut into the soil. Continue rotating until the desired depth is reached, then extract loosened soil by withdrawing the auger and shaking off excess earth. For denser or compacted soils, loosen the top layer with a spade or garden fork before using the auger to reduce effort and wear on the tool. Maintain an upright posture and use both hands on the handle to keep control.
Use the awtools AW00104 hand auger in soils that are not heavily rocky. For best results in clay or compacted ground, pre-loosen soil and avoid forcing the auger to prevent damage. Clean the auger after each use, remove soil from the shaft and blade, dry it and store in a dry place to preserve the powder coating and prevent corrosion. Wear appropriate hand protection and eye protection when working in debris-prone areas.
